How do places that give people dental insurance determine whether or not someone has a preexisting condition?

- Well, your new dentist can tell them right off. He'll note any noot canals, cavities, work you've had done. If he finds a cavity right off, that's a pre exisitng condition. The insurance companies only care when you file a claim for a pre-exisitng.
- There are several ways. For instance if you need a bridge to replace tooth, when the dentist sends in a pre op x-ray, they can see if you already have a tooth missing. Many dental insurances don't have a pre existing clause.
